At least 25 of them arrived in Cagayan de Oro aboard a 2Go vessel last May 19.
Nine from the group were immediately quarantined in Cagayan de Oro while the Maguindanao provincial government fetched 16 other students and brought them back to their province.
Dr. Joselito Retuya, chief epidemiologist at the Cagayan de Oro City Health Office, said the latest to be found positive of COVID-19 was a 25-year-old female student, a resident of Barangay Lumbia here.
Retuya said the student has cough, diarrhea and is experiencing shortness of breath but is in stable condition.
The first in the group of students to have been found positive of the coronavirus was a 26-year-old architectural student who hails from Iligan City.
Retuya said the source of the students’ infection might be at the port of Cebu where they stayed for four days while waiting for passage to Cagayan de Oro. He added that it was unlikely that the students were infected at the boat as it was only an overnight travel.
He said the nine students were quarantined in an undisclosed place in Cagayan de Oro soon after they arrived.
